Re: [PATCH, i386, MPX, 1/X] Support of Intel MPX ISA. 1/2 Bound type and modes


On 10/23/13 04:57, Ilya Enkovich wrote:

2013-10-23  Ilya Enkovich  <ilya.enkovich@intel.com>

	* mode-classes.def (MODE_POINTER_BOUNDS): New.
	* tree.def (POINTER_BOUNDS_TYPE): New.
	* genmodes.c (complete_mode): Support MODE_POINTER_BOUNDS.
	(POINTER_BOUNDS_MODE): New.
	(make_pointer_bounds_mode): New.
	* machmode.h (POINTER_BOUNDS_MODE_P): New.
	* stor-layout.c (int_mode_for_mode): Support MODE_POINTER_BOUNDS.
	(layout_type): Support POINTER_BOUNDS_TYPE.
	* tree-pretty-print.c (dump_generic_node): Support POINTER_BOUNDS_TYPE.
	* tree.c (build_int_cst_wide): Support POINTER_BOUNDS_TYPE.
	(type_contains_placeholder_1): Likewise.
	* tree.h (POINTER_BOUNDS_TYPE_P): New.
	* varasm.c (output_constant): Support POINTER_BOUNDS_TYPE.
	* doc/rtl.texi (MODE_POINTER_BOUNDS): New.
OK for the trunk. IIRC, there was a backend patch with conditional approval that should be good to go now (conditional upon the acceptance of the types/modes patch).

Note that since I asked for a couple things to be renamed that backend patch might need tweaking. If so, make the obvious changes, post the patch (so it's recorded into the archives) and go ahead and check it into the trunk.
